Today we have a special guest: Maisie Williams, who plays Arya Stark on Game of Thrones, is here to tell you about Daisie, the new app that she and her co-founder Dom Santry are launching today. 😻

Hello Product Hunt! It's Maisie. Dom and I had a wonderful time in San Francisco, and heard that this is the place to be on launch day!

Success in the creative industries is wholly dependent on luck and ‘ins’. When I was 12, I auditioned for every stage school in London and didn’t get in. Had I not got Game of Thrones, that probably would have been the end of it for me, so I’ve always pictured that person who these opportunities were not around for.

At Daisie, we are building a platform for creators to showcase their original work, collaborate, and make meaningful connections. You have a profile, and you have a timeline, but the way your profile grows is by the chains that you make. To make a chain with someone, you have to work together. It’s a two way connection that encourages discovery and collaboration.

Our ultimate goal is to give the power back to the creator. Opportunity comes by working together, and when people's work speaks for itself – without being validated by a follower count or a casting director.

We're a team of six (come work with us!). We'd love to hear your feedback and suggestions, and I'll be around on Product Hunt today answering questions, ask me anything (except for the Game of Thrones ending).
